The Department of Telecommunications (DoT) has launched a 12-week online course on 5G to train and certify its officials on the next-generation wireless broadband technology. Through the course, DoT aims to create an in-house pool of 5G experts and policy makers for 5G.

According to DoT, the objective of launching the course is to have a team of master trainers and 5G security experts within the DoT, who would formulate a roadmap for reinforcing education and awareness levels about 5G and also identify lacunae in existing legislations.

The DoT’s training arm National Telecommunications Institute for Policy Research, Innovation and Training (NTIPRIT) will conduct the online 5G certification course for DoT staff.

The course will act as a capsule programme for learning overall 5G technology from the perspective of policy making. Though the 5G certification course will initially be available to DoT staff, it will eventually be offered to other stakeholders too.
